2. LinkedIn Ads for AI Companies: Where They Work & Where They Fail


Where Ads Work Well

  • Re-targeting people who've already visited your website
  • Awareness at scale (broad reach fast)
  • Enterprise reminders (CTO, CIO audiences)
  • Hiring campaigns for niche roles


Where Ads Struggle

AI concepts need explanation, not one-line ad copy.

Ads cannot explain:

  • RAG systems
  • agent workflows
  • LLM architecture logic
  • how embeddings work
  • why inference speed matters
  • where AI fits in a workflow
  • how automation actually saves time


Most AI buyers skip ads because:

  • they feel like “marketing”
  • no trust
  • too generic
  • too surface-level
  • not technical enough


Realistic Ad Metrics for AI Category

  • CTR: 0.25% – 0.7%
  • Demo conversion: 2% – 6%
  • CAC: ₹300 – ₹900 per click
  • Quality: mixed
  • Trust: low

AI buyers want clarity, not slogans.

Ads simply can't deliver depth.

4. ROI Comparison: Ads vs Creators


LinkedIn Ads ROI

  • High cost per click
  • Lower trust
  • Limited narrative depth
  • Good only for scale + retargeting


LinkedIn Creators ROI

  • Lower effective CPC (₹15–₹60)
  • High-quality demo traffic
  • 4–8x better trust
  • Higher signups and trial conversions
  • Strong bottom-funnel impact
  • Repeatable GTM influence


Real Creator Metrics for AI Category

  • CTR: 1.2% – 3.8%
  • Demo conversion: 10% – 30%
  • Trial activation: high
  • CAC: far lower than ads
  • Brand lift: extremely high

Creators win by a huge margin.


5. The Funnel: When to Use Ads, When to Use Creators


Use Creators for:

  • product launches
  • workflow explanations
  • demos
  • technical breakdowns
  • category education
  • founder credibility
  • early adopters
  • PLG motion
  • bottom-funnel conversion


Use Ads for:

  • retargeting traffic
  • hiring niche roles
  • broad awareness
  • enterprise-scale reminders

Creators → understanding.

Ads → distribution.

Both work, but creators drive adoption.


6. Common Mistakes AI Companies Make


Mistake #1: Using general influencers for AI

AI needs technical voices, not lifestyle creators.


Mistake #2: Treating creator posts like ads

Creators must explain, not “promote.”


Mistake #3: Expecting instant conversions

AI adoption takes multiple exposures.


Mistake #4: Using unverified creator data

Screenshots and Google Forms can be wrong or inflated.


Always use:

✓ LinkedIn-verified impressions

✓ audience demographics

✓ seniority data

✓ past collab integrity
